- gomox 12y agoEven for average guys, the picture is a welcome visual element in resumes. US-centric resumes tend to be very wall-of-texty because of the "ALL RESUMES SHOULD BE X PAGES LONG" (X in {1,2}) policy forbidding the use of "wasteful" whitespace.
- gomox 12y agoThis is really a cultural issue. In the US, pictures are a big no-no but in my experience with LATAM and European companies, pictures are common if not expected. Design wise, the picture is a good opportunity for visual appeal.
